Template:Infobox/Mobile Weapon Ver.2 The FF-3 Saberfish is an Aerial Fighter from the MSV (Mobile Suit Variations) design series.
Technology & Combat Characteristics
The FF-3 Saberfish is an atmospheric interceptor aircraft and the base model of FF-S3 Saberfish in a joint effort by the Earth Federation Space Force (EFSF) and Eath Federation Air Force (EFAF). The rocket engines are deleted in favor of pylons for mounting missiles and drop tanks. Other features include a revised cockpit canopy and wing-fuselage blending for reduced stall occurrence.
Armaments
- 25mm Vulcan Gun
- Air-to-Air Missile
History
The FF-3 Saberfish was produced for the EFAF and were delivered to Federation air bases around the globe. After the One Year War, the EFAF also adopts the space-use FF-S3 Saberfish originally operated by the EFSF.
